Huawei has announced its new electric car Luxeed.
Huawei, one of the leading technology companies in the world, has recently made headlines with its announcement of a new electric car called Luxeed. This move marks Huawei’s entry into the highly competitive electric vehicle market, which has been rapidly growing in recent years.
The Luxeed is expected to be a game-changer in the electric car industry, as Huawei brings its expertise in technology and innovation to the table. The company is known for its cutting-edge smartphones, telecommunications equipment, and other consumer electronics. With Luxeed, Huawei aims to revolutionize the automotive industry by integrating advanced technology into their electric vehicles.
One of the key features of Luxeed is its autonomous driving capabilities. Huawei has been investing heavily in artificial intelligence and machine learning, and these technologies will be leveraged to enable Luxeed to navigate roads and traffic without human intervention. This is a significant step towards the future of transportation, where self-driving cars are expected to become the norm.
In addition to autonomous driving, Luxeed will also incorporate advanced connectivity features. Huawei’s expertise in telecommunications will allow the car to seamlessly connect to the internet and other devices, providing a truly connected experience for its users. This means that Luxeed drivers will have access to a wide range of services and applications, making their driving experience more convenient and enjoyable.
Another area where Huawei aims to differentiate Luxeed is in its battery technology. The company has been investing in research and development to improve the energy storage capabilities of its batteries. This will result in longer driving ranges and faster charging times, addressing one of the major concerns of electric vehicle owners.
Furthermore, Luxeed will feature a sleek and futuristic design, reflecting Huawei’s commitment to aesthetics and user experience. The car will be equipped with state-of-the-art infotainment systems, touchscreens, and other interactive interfaces, providing a luxurious and high-tech interior.
